Below we explain how to grow avocados at home , to save money and always have them available, completely natural and organic.
Take an avocado seed, clean it well and insert 4 toothpicks, equidistant from each other, then dip it in 3 centimeters of water. Place the glass in a warm, sunny place.
The root will take 2-8 weeks to grow and once it reaches a length of around 15cm it will become visible and will need to be cut to a length of 8cm. After a few days, the leaves will also appear.
Fill a fairly large pot with nutrient-rich potting soil and poke a hole in the center. Insert the seed, leaving half of it above the soil.
Place the pot in a sunny location and water it daily. The tree may take several years to bear fruit.
